How much does a State Program Manager make?
As of May 28, 2026, the average annual pay for a State Program Manager in the United States is $107,460 a year.
Just in case you need a simple salary calculator, that works out to be approximately $51.66 an hour. This is the equivalent of $2,066/week or $8,955/month.
While ZipRecruiter is seeing annual salaries as high as $156,500 and as low as $38,500, the majority of State Program Manager salaries currently range between $79,500 (25th percentile) to $132,500 (75th percentile) with top earners (90th percentile) making $143,000 annually across the United States. The average pay range for a State Program Manager varies greatly (by as much as 53000), which suggests there may be many opportunities for advancement and increased pay based on skill level, location and years of experience.
A State Program Manager in your area makes on average $103,796 per year, or $3,664 (3.410%) less than the national average annual salary of $107,460. Ohio ranks number 30 out of 50 states nationwide for State Program Manager salaries.

What are Top 10 Highest Paying Cities for State Program Manager Jobs
We've identified 10 cities where the typical salary for a State Program Manager job is above the national average. Topping the list is Barrow, AK, , with Nome, AK, and Cupertino, CA, close behind in the second and third positions. Cupertino, CA, beats the national average by $25,119 (23.4%), and Barrow, AK, furthers that trend with another $26,411 (24.6%) above the $107,460 average.
With these 10 cities having average salaries higher than the national average, the opportunities for economic advancement by changing locations as a State Program Manager appears to be exceedingly fruitful.
Finally, another factor to consider is the average salary for these top 10 cities varies very little at 6% between Barrow, AK, and Buford, WY, , reinforcing the limited potential for much wage advancement. The possibility of a lower cost of living may be the best factor to use when considering location and salary for a State Program Manager role.
City | Annual Salary | Hourly Wage |
|---|---|---|
Barrow, AK | $133,871 | $64.36 |
Nome, AK | $133,304 | $64.09 |
Cupertino, CA | $132,579 | $63.74 |
Sitka, AK | $129,455 | $62.24 |
Wyoming, WY | $128,160 | $61.62 |
Sunnyvale, CA | $128,080 | $61.58 |
Mountain View, CA | $126,704 | $60.92 |
Menlo Park, CA | $126,638 | $60.88 |
San Francisco, CA | $126,607 | $60.87 |
Buford, WY | $126,065 | $60.61 |
